Beyond the obvious protagonists, the setting of Tingen City itself feels like a character in the early arcs—its foggy streets, the Blackthorn Security Company, the ordinary people oblivious to the dangers. Key figures emerge from that atmosphere: Dunn Smith, the weary team leader, and his unspoken tragedy; the poor, cursed Sealed Artifact 2-049 that just wants to hug people. They establish the cost and melancholy of this world before the scale explodes to cosmic levels. Klein's identity as 'Zhou Mingrui' from his past life is arguably his most foundational character layer, influencing every cautious decision he makes.

That's a neat question to dig into, because 'Lord of the Mysteries' has such a sprawling cast. It's not just about one hero; it's about this whole ecosystem of factions and the people navigating them.

Klein Moretti, or The Fool as he becomes known, is obviously the core. We follow his transformation from a clerk bewilderedly waking up in a new world to a master schemer pulling strings from the shadows. What I find fascinating isn't just his power growth, but how he desperately clings to his humanity and morality even as he ascends to godhood. His internal monologues about maintaining his 'acting' and not losing himself are the real heart of the story for me.

Beyond him, you've got the Tarot Club members who orbit him—like the ever-loyal Audrey Hall (Justice) and Alger Wilson (The Hanged Man). They're not just sidekicks; they have their own arcs, ambitions, and fears, and seeing them piece together the truth about 'Mr. Fool' is half the fun. Then there are the antagonistic forces like Amon, the god of deceit, who is less a villain and more an unstoppable force of nature with a terrifying sense of humor. Characters like Leonard Mitchell, with his quirky poet roommate Pallez Zoroast, add this weird, grounded warmth to the whole cosmic horror vibe. It's the interplay between all these personalities, from the lofty deities to the struggling Beyonders on the ground, that makes the world feel so alarmingly alive and layered.

Key characters? You have to start with Klein, no question. But the real magic for me was in the side cast. Audrey started off seeming like just a noble lady playing at philanthropy, but her journey into becoming a genuine psychologist and pillar of the Tarot Club was incredibly satisfying. And Alger's struggle with his past and his desire for redemption gave the whole 'power at a cost' theme so much weight.

I also think the antagonists deserve a special mention because they're not just obstacles. Amon is genuinely unsettling in a way few villains are—stealing identities and time itself, always wearing that monocle. And then there's Adam, who operates on a completely different, godlike plane. Their schemes and the constant sense of being watched or manipulated raised the stakes so high. You can't talk about key players without mentioning the deities themselves, like the Evernight Goddess, whose subtle manipulations guide so much of the plot from the shadows. It's less a hero's journey and more a complex web where every thread matters.

Honestly, I see a lot of lists that just name the main crew and stop there. I think a truly key character often overlooked is Azik Eggers. He's this mysterious, amnesiac mentor figure for Klein, a powerful Nighthawk, but his personal quest to recover his memories of his son ties the emotional core of the story to the larger mysteries of death and reincarnation. His presence grounds Klein's journey in something more than just survival and power-leveling.

Similarly, Old Neil's tragic arc in the very beginning sets the tone for the entire Beyonder pathway's dangers. And what about Bernadette Gustav? She's a link to Roselle and carries a whole different strand of the history. The beauty of 'LotM' is that even seemingly minor characters can have massive implications later, because the world's rules of fate, sefirot, and symbolism mean everyone is potentially a piece on the board. Forgetting the side characters means missing half the story's intricate design.

Having devoured both the 'Lord of the Mysteries' novel and its manga adaptation, I’d say they’re like two sides of the same mystical coin. The novel’s depth is staggering—Cuttlefish’s world-building is so intricate that every alley in Backlund feels alive, and Klein’s internal monologues add layers to his paranoia and growth. The manga, while visually stunning, inevitably condenses some of that richness. Scenes like the Tarot Club meetings lose a bit of their slow-burn tension, but the art captures the Lovecraftian horror beautifully. The manga’s pacing races through arcs, so newcomers might miss subtle foreshadowing, like the significance of Antigonus’ notebook. That said, the manga’s visuals elevate certain moments—Amon’s eerie grin or the Fool’s golden masks feel more visceral. If the novel is a 10-course banquet, the manga’s a gourmet highlight reel. I’d recommend both, but start with the novel to savor the lore.
